Linux作为一种开源的操作系统,是目前世界上最为流行的服务器操作系统之一。同时,随着互联网的发展,Web服务器的需求越来越大,因此如何在Linux系统上搭建Web服务器也成为了一项很重要的技能。本文将从多个角度分析如何在Linux系统上搭建Web服务器。
第一步:选择Web服务器软件
在搭建Web服务器之前,我们需要选择一款适合我们需求的Web服务器软件。常见的Web服务器软件有Apache、Nginx等。Apache作为最为流行的Web服务器软件,其安装和使用也比较简单。如果考虑到性能等因素,可以选择Nginx等其他Web服务器软件。
第二步:安装Web服务器软件
安装Web服务器软件的方式也有多种。我们可以通过源码安装、二进制文件安装、包管理器安装等方式安装Web服务器软件。其中,包管理器安装是比较简单的方式。以Ubuntu为例,安装Apache的命令为 sudo apt-get install apache2,而安装Nginx的命令为 sudo apt-get install nginx。
第三步:配置Web服务器
成功安装Web服务器之后,需要进行一些配置,以便于更好地使用Web服务器。其中,最基本的配置就是Web服务器的监听端口。默认情况下,Apache的监听端口为80端口,而Nginx的监听端口为8080端口。我们可以通过修改配置文件来更改监听端口等参数。
第四步:部署Web应用程序
安装并配置好Web服务器之后,我们还需要将Web应用程序部署到Web服务器上。常见的Web应用程序有静态网页、动态网页、Web应用等。我们可以通过FTP等工具将Web应用程序上传到Web服务器上,并在配置文件中进行相应的设置。
第五步:测试Web服务器
最后,我们需要测试Web服务器是否能够正常工作。我们可以通过浏览器等工具,访问Web服务器的IP地址和监听端口,检查Web应用程序是否正常运行。同时,我们也可以通过Web服务器的日志文件等方式,来进行Web服务器的监控和调试。
扫码咨询 领取资料